In-Place Inclinometer

The INC500 is our latest in-place inclinometer model replacing the INC320. The INC500 includes a network of the latest MEMS technology sensors and improved signal conditioning and data acquisition electronics within a flexible plastic, low-profile, watertight housing. A new centralizer attached to the outside of the INC500 housing allows for installation in standard 2.75-inch diameter inclinometer casing. This new centralizer has four stainless steel wheel assemblies providing stabilized positioning in all directions. The INC500 also features a new coupler providing improved assembly of adjacent inclinometer modules.
The INC500 system integrates an entire network of digital tilt measurements over a single cable connected to a GCM controller. Complete results are communicated from the GCM to a server computer via wireless internet modems. The INC500 offers many distinct features that make it an attractive alternative or replacement for traditional borehole inclinometer type systems.
The INC500 greatly simplifies field installation, reduces field data collection costs, and provides continuous web-based monitoring. Complete inclinometer results can be viewed from any web browser with a connection to the internet. Sample System
The illustration to the below shows how five modules (model INC310) can be assembled to provide a 40-foot long in-place inclinometer system. Tilt measurements are collected simultaneously at multiple depths resulting in a profile of slope change over depth. Finally, a displacement profile is calculated by integrating the tilt profile information.

Readings are collected by our controller module and transmitted via an internet modem for unattended remote operation. Alternatively, a laptop computer or other data logger equipment can be used to interface with the controller unit using simple RS-232 protocol commands.
Performance
The INC300 series in-place inclinometer consists of a series of self-contained instrumentation modules.
Each module contains a series of precisely spaced sensors capable of measuring acceleration, tilt, and temperature based on user
selectable operation modes.
Tilt readings at known locations along the length of the INC can be evaluated using numerical integration techniques to produce displacement profiles like the results shown on the figure to the right.
Field Installation
INC300 Series inclinometer modules installed in a borehole using a bentonite cement grout mix. Modules are joined together quickly using snap-on couplers, and additional support can be acheived using duct tape or adhesive lined heat shrink tube. The square shape of the inclinometer housing provides a simple and reliable way to achieve correct tilt sensor alignment during installation. Alignment tabs and mating slots ensure that all modules are oriented in the same direction.

Model Description
The INC310, INC320, and INC330 inclinometer models provide different levels of accuracy by inclusion of 4, 8, and 16 internal tilt sensors (MEMS accelerometers), respectively.
